Shonhaugen Park is a park in Minnesota, at a modelled 299 m. Hurrle Peak stands 370 m to the northwest, 22 miles off. The nearest named place is Curly Park, a park 0.2 miles away. Great River Road passes 11 miles off. 2 named summits stand within 25 miles.

Months averaging 50–80 °F: May–Sep.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 12 | 17 | 30 | 44 | 57 | 67 | 71 | 69 | 61 | 47 | 32 | 19 |
| Precip in | 0.7 | 1.0 | 1.4 | 2.6 | 4.2 | 4.4 | 4.3 | 4.5 | 3.4 | 2.5 | 1.5 | 1.1 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Buffalo 2NE, 4 mi away.
